

A raw report from Rio de Janeiro shows how poor residents fight for space and dignity on beaches often treated as exclusive, exposing the social tensions behind a seemingly simple day at the sea.
The Poor Go to the Beach was directed by Bruno Villas Boas and Nelson Hoineff.
The Poor Go to the Beach runs for 30min, and was released in 1989.
